Abstract(in English) | On wireless LANs, a mobile host handovers between wireless LAN access points where characteristics such as delay, bandwidth and packet-loss rate are different. If a new destination access point is congested, mobile host's effective bandwidth will rapidly decrease, and it will cause unfairness of data sending rate between preexistent nodes at the new access point and the mobile host. To prevent such unfairness, it will be effective to calculate new sending rate based on the available bandwidth at a new access point. In this paper propose to use jitter to predict available bandwidth at a new access point for DCCP CCID3. Simulation results show that we can estimate DCCP sending rate using jitter at a access point and applying the estimated sending rate to the sending rate of a mobile host just after a handover is effective. |
